About the Ford Ranger 3.0L V6 Diesel
The Next Gen Ford Ranger 3.0L V6 Diesel is one of Australia’s most capable dual-cab platforms, combining strong towing performance with modern drivability and efficiency.
From the factory, the 3.0-litre V6 turbo-diesel produces 156kW and 500Nm (flywheel), paired with Ford’s 10-speed automatic transmission and rated to tow 3,500kg. While highly capable, the factory calibration prioritises emissions compliance, global fuel quality, and drivetrain protection — leaving noticeable performance untapped.

DPF-Back Exhaust Upgrade
The Next-Gen Ford Ranger 3.0 V6 factory exhaust system is a restrictive, press-bent, mass-produced assembly that increases backpressure once torque is raised through ECU calibration. As power and load demand increase, the limitations of the OE pipe diameter transitions and chambered muffler design become more evident. Our 3.5” mandrel-bent DPF-back system is engineered to reduce post-DPF restriction, improve mid-range torque delivery, and support stable exhaust gas temperatures under towing and sustained load. The result is improved turbocharger efficiency, more responsive torque delivery, and a refined exhaust note without excessive cabin drone. To maintain compliance, this system begins after the factory Diesel Particulate Filter (DPF), maintaining full emissions functionality and compliance with Australian Design Rules (ADR). The DPF remains untouched and continues to operate as designed, including active and passive regeneration cycles. An inbuilt resonator is fitted as standard to ensure optimal acoustic control while maintaining exhaust flow efficiency. The system is manufactured as a full 3.5” mandrel-bent stainless steel configuration to ensure consistent internal diameter and smooth-radius transitions throughout. Transmission Cooler Upgrade
The factory 10-speed automatic transmission cooling system is calibrated around standard torque output and general-use duty cycles. When engine torque is increased through ECU calibration, or the vehicle is used for towing, touring, larger tyres, or sustained highway load, transmission heat generation increases significantly. Our twin-core supplementary transmission cooler upgrade is engineered to provide additional thermal capacity beyond the OE system, helping maintain stable automatic transmission fluid (ATF) temperatures under high-load and high-ambient conditions. Increased torque output and sustained load can elevate ATF temperatures beyond ideal operating thresholds. Excessive heat can influence torque converter clutch stability, adaptive shift behaviour, and long-term clutch pack durability. By increasing external cooling surface area and airflow efficiency, the twin-core design improves heat rejection while retaining correct hydraulic flow characteristics within the transmission system. The result is more stable shift performance and improved thermal headroom during towing and heavy-duty operation. This system operates as a supplementary cooling stage, working in conjunction with the factory heat exchanger rather than replacing it. This ensures correct warm-up characteristics are retained while providing additional cooling capacity once operating temperatures rise. The twin-core configuration is selected to balance cooling efficiency with pressure stability, ensuring no adverse impact on transmission line pressure or control strategies. Mounting and hose routing are designed to maintain OEM flow direction and structural reliability in off-road and touring applications. This upgrade is particularly recommended for vehicles operating above factory torque levels or frequently exposed to high ambient conditions in the northern parts of Australia.
